#1463e8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1463e8 is composed of 7.8% red, 38.8%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.4% cyan, 57.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 217.6 degrees, a saturation of 84.1% and a lightness of 49.4%. #1463e8 color hex could be obtained by blending #28c6ff with #0000d1. Closest websafe color is: #0066ff.

#1463e8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1463e8 has RGB values of R:20, G:99, B:232 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 1336296.

Shades and Tints of #1463e8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01070f is the darkest color, while #fcf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1463e8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757c87 is the less saturated color, while #015efb is the most saturated one.
